Vista is a beautiful city in the state of California, United States, located more exactly in San Diego County, 7 miles inland from the Pacific Ocean. According to the 2010 census, Vista has a total population of 93,834 residents and spans on a total area of 18.678 square miles. Vista is a great city, being listed as the 7th best place for family life in the country. Nevertheless, Vista is also a great tourist destination, since it provides a multitude of recreational and cultural opportunities.

Top Attractions within Vista

The Wave Waterpark is a great provider of family fun in Vista, as it gives both locals and tourists the chance to cool off in the hot summer days. Children will be thrilled with the variety of slides, rides and other water attractions featured by the park. The park also has a great food place where you can grab a bite.

The Antique Gas & Steam Engine Museum is a nice cultural institution in Vista that dates back to 1969. The museum is open all year round and it welcomes its visitors with numerous interesting exhibits, including steam engines, tractors, blacksmiths, and many more.

Rancho Guajome Adobe is a historic site in Vista, designating an adobe house that served as a Spanish Colonial hacienda. The ranch was built in 1852 and was listed on the National Register of Historic Places in 1970.
